solve by completing the square?
x^2-6x-3=0
Rearrange:
x^2-6x+? = 3+?
Now, complete the square
x^2-6x+(6/2)^2 = 3+(6/2)^2
Factor the left side and evaluate the right side:
(x-3)^2 = 12
Take the square root of both sides to get:
x-3 = 2sqrt3 or x-3=-2sqrt3
Solve for x to get:
x=3+2sqrt3 or x=3-2sqrt3
